Quote:
steve theres a few things wrong with that engine bay as i sold that car to guy and he made a few mistakes but what do you expect from an e body man.
I see Positive battery cable Cyl head mounted heater hose bracket not supposed to be on a 1969 and older ????? missing heat shield upper shock washer hardware wiper motor ??????
why does it have a black booster in one pic and a zinc one in the other pic
